Heterogeneous conducting polymer nanostructures are fabricated using a newly developed method. Completely isolated nanowires of several conducting polymer materials can be fabricated side‐by‐side with perfect registry to each other on a rigid or flexible substrate. Results of a chemical sensing study using PPY and PEDOT nanowires are presented (see figure).
